Vehicle Mounted Aerial Lifts (OSHA)

COURSE OVERVIEW

This OSHA-focused Vehicle Mounted Aerial Lifts course gives workers the essential knowledge needed to operate bucket trucks and cherry pickers safely. These lifts are used daily in utilities, construction, municipal services, and roadside maintenance. Because they raise workers and equipment to significant heights, proper training is critical for preventing falls, collisions, and equipment failures.

Learners explore regulatory requirements, lift anatomy, inspection routines, stability concepts, and hazard recognition. The course also outlines step-by-step guidance for job planning, site setup, safe maneuvering, and proper refueling. Additional modules address communication methods and what to do during emergencies or rescue situations. By completing this course, workers will be prepared to use a vehicle-mounted aerial lift with confidence and compliance.

TOPIC OVERVIEW

Aerial lift safety depends on understanding equipment behavior, environmental risks, and operator responsibilities. This topic introduces the fundamentals of how vehicle-mounted lifts work, why stability matters, and how hazards develop, giving learners a strong base for safer performance on the job.
